Mastering Dependency Injection Modules

Dependency injection (DI) is a fundamental design pattern in software development that promotes modularity. By injecting dependencies into classes instead of having them hardcoded, you create flexible applications. DI modules play a crucial role in managing these dependencies, providing a centralized mechanism for configuring and resolving them. Mastering DI modules empowers developers to build robust and efficient systems. To effectively leverage DI modules, developers should grasp core concepts such as dependency scopes, lifetime management, and container configurations. A deep understanding of these aspects allows for the creation of complex applications that adhere to solid design principles.

Utilizing Dependency Injection Modules in Software Development

Dependency injection containers are essential for building scalable software applications. By implementing loose coupling between components, dependency injection supports easier testing. Developers can provide dependencies into classes through constructors or interfaces, generating in modular code. This pattern also simplifies the process of integration testing.

Ultimately, dependency injection modules empower developers to build more efficient software architectures that are more to maintain and evolve over time.
